Landgraaf is a railway station in Landgraaf, Netherlands, situated near the district Schaesberg. Before 1986, it was called Schaesberg. The station was opened on 1 May 1896 and is located on the Sittard–Herzogenrath railway and the Heuvellandlijn (Maastricht–Kerkrade). Services are operated by Arriva and Deutsche Bahn.

Train services

The following train services call at this station:

  • Express RE 18: Heerlen–Herzogenrath
  • Local Stoptrein: Sittard–Heerlen–Kerkrade
